Examples
-
Converting 2 Mega Btu (IT) results in 1,556,338,524.58 foot-pounds of energy.
-
Converting 0.5 Mega Btu (IT) equals 389,084,631.15 foot-pounds.

Frequently Asked Questions
-
What is a mega Btu (IT)?
-
A mega Btu (IT) equals one million British thermal units as defined by the International Table, measuring thermal energy.
-
What does a foot-pound represent?
-
A foot-pound measures energy as work done by a one pound-force through one foot of displacement.
-
Why convert mega Btu (IT) to foot-pound?
-
Converting helps relate heat content used in fuel and heating industries to mechanical energy used in engineering and mechanics.
Key Terminology
-
Mega Btu (IT)
-
One million British thermal units as per the International Table, measuring thermal energy or heat.
-
Foot-pound (ft*lbf)
-
An imperial unit of energy representing work done by a force of one pound-force over a distance of one foot.
